How long has LeBron been signed with Nike for?
Nike offered LeBron James an estimated $87-to-$90 million across 7 years to sign with them. But the biggest offer made to LeBron James was from Reebok, who offered LeBron a mammoth $110 million contract over 10 years.

How much does Nike pay LeBron a year?
In 2016, James signed a “lifetime” contract with Nike that is said to be more than $30 million a year and was hinted by his business partner Maverick Carter, according to Business Insider, to be worth more than a billion dollars.
How much is LeBron James Nike deal?
James and Nike agreed to a seven-year deal worth $90 million, which was the richest shoe deal in NBA history — and James hadn’t made his debut yet. Then in 2016, James and Nike continued their partnership and agreed on a lifetime deal worth $30 million a year.

Who is Nike owned by?
4 The co-founder of Nike, Phil Knight, and his son Travis Knight, along with the holding companies and trusts they control, own more than 97% of outstanding Class A shares. 5 This allows the Knight family to exercise effective control of Nike even though it is a publicly traded business.

How much Nike pay Jordan?
Meanwhile, Jordan’s deal with Nike included a clause for royalties. According to Essentially Sports, Jordan gets 5% from each Air Jordan sale; this is how he has been able to make $150 million per year.

Will LeBron be a billionaire?
LeBron James has officially become a billionaire, according to Forbes. This makes James the first active NBA player to reach the milestone, and the second NBA player to reach billionaire status, joining retired basketball star Michael Jordan.

Did Kobe have a lifetime deal with Nike?
Kobe Bryant’s estate has reached a new long-term contract with Nike to continue producing both footwear and apparel from Bryant’s Zoom Kobe series, Vanessa Bryant and Nike announced on Thursday. The news comes nearly a year after Kobe Bryant’s initial endorsement deal with Nike expired.

Who signed the biggest contract in NBA history?
Shaquille O’Neal, Los Angeles Lakers
Speaking of Orlando, one of its biggest ever stars left the team for an unprecedented free agent deal in 1996. O’Neal signed the largest contract in NBA history at the time and made it worth every penny for the Lakers, who had a championship three-peat during his eight-year tenure.
